What is a Teledata?

A Teledata job typically involves the installation, maintenance, and troubleshooting of telecommunications and data communication systems. Professionals in this field work with network cabling, fiber optics, VoIP systems, and other telecommunication technologies. They may be responsible for ensuring reliable data transmission in businesses, government agencies, or service providers. Strong technical skills and knowledge of industry standards are often required.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in the Teledata position, and why are they important?

To excel as a Teledata professional, you should have a solid understanding of telecommunications and data systems, supported by relevant technical education or certifications in areas such as structured cabling, fiber optics, or network infrastructure. Experience with tools like cable testers, labeling software, and network management platforms is typically necessary. Strong problem-solving abilities, attention to detail, and effective communication are critical soft skills for this position. These competencies are essential for ensuring reliable data connectivity, efficient troubleshooting, and smooth collaboration with IT teams and clients.

What are the typical responsibilities of a Teledata technician on a daily basis?

A typical day for a Teledata technician involves installing, maintaining, and troubleshooting data and telecommunication cabling systems in office buildings, data centers, or industrial settings. You may be tasked with running and terminating cables, testing network connectivity, documenting installations, and addressing service tickets. Collaboration with IT professionals, project managers, and sometimes clients is common to ensure systems are functioning as required. A focus on quality, safety, and timely completion of tasks helps ensure the success of both individual projects and the overall team.

Job description

Position Summary

Teledata Technologies is seeking an experienced Physical Security Systems Technician to configure, program, commission, integrate, and troubleshoot physical security systems. The Systems Division serves as a specialized technical resource for Teledata's project teams. When this expertise is required, Systems Technicians are deployed across projects to support configuration, commissioning, and other technical needs. This position does not manage the overall project or direct installation personnel.

Primary Responsibilities

•  Configure and program physical security hardware, software, servers, databases, controllers, cameras, workstations, and connected devices.

•  Commission systems and verify device communication, recording, access-control functions, alarms, intercom operation, analytics, and integrations.

•  Coordinate assigned technical work with Project Managers and the Systems Field Supervisor.

•  Identify and document installation or infrastructure deficiencies that prevent successful configuration or commissioning, and communicate corrective requirements to the Project Manager.

•  Diagnose hardware, software, network, database, communication, and integration problems.

•  Provide technical assistance to other Teledata personnel when requested.

•  Maintain accurate programming files, system backups, device records, test results, commissioning checklists, and service notes.

•  Support customer demonstrations, training, acceptance testing, and system turnover.

•  Protect customer credentials, network information, programming files, and other sensitive system information.

Systems and Technologies

•  Video surveillance and video management systems

•  Electronic access-control systems

•  Intrusion-detection systems

•  Intercom and emergency communication systems

•  License plate recognition systems

•  Security servers, workstations, databases, and virtual environments

•  IP networks, PoE switches, and integrated security platforms

Experience with every platform used by Teledata is not required. Candidates should have hands-on programming, commissioning, or troubleshooting experience with at least one recognized physical security product line.

Minimum Qualifications

•  Five or more years of relevant hands-on experience is preferred. Applicable college education, technical training, manufacturer training, or military experience may be considered in place of a portion of the experience requirement.

•  Strong understanding of physical security system configuration, commissioning, and troubleshooting.

•  Working knowledge of IP addressing, subnetting, network communication, PoE, and basic network troubleshooting.

•  Ability to read drawings, wiring diagrams, device schedules, specifications, and manufacturer documentation.

•  Strong technical documentation and communication skills.

•  Valid driver's license with an acceptable driving record.

•  Ability to complete and pass a background check and drug screening.

Preferred Qualifications

•  Manufacturer certifications in surveillance, access control, intrusion, intercom, or networking.

•  Experience commissioning integrated physical security systems.

•  Familiarity with Milestone XProtect, Hanwha WAVE, Axis, LenelS2 OnGuard, DMP, 2N, or comparable platforms.

•  Experience with servers, databases, virtual machines, and managed networks.

Physical Requirements

•  Ability to work at customer sites, equipment rooms, and active construction sites.

•  Ability to use ladders or lifts when required to inspect, test, aim, or commission devices.

•  Ability to lift and carry computers, testing equipment, tools, and related materials.

•  Ability to wear required personal protective equipment.
